During our 88-year history the League has provided thousands of dollars and volunteer hours to support our community. This year, our League’s focus on the issues of children and families in need has generated collaborations with the Connecticut Food Bank, New Haven Home Recovery, the New Haven Public Schools, and All Our Kin. Through these partnerships, our League has provided more than 1,300 hours of volunteer service, has donated more than 1,000 books to the New Haven Public Schools, and has helped to bring awareness to and alleviate such community issues as childhood obesity, domestic violence, and illiteracy. Founded in 1923, the Junior League of Greater New Haven is a not-for-profit women's volunteer organization that has sought to effect positive change in the Greater New Haven community by promoting voluntarism, developing the potential of women, and supporting the effective action and leadership of trained volunteers.
